Though it has largely stripped down to being a pure media play, there is a compelling operational depth at Tiso Blackstar Group (TBG) that most market watchers have been overlooking. The core remains Times Media Group — the largest national English publishing group (with titles like the Sunday Times, Business Day, the Sowetan and the Financial Mail) but the company has made great strides online and now ranks as the second-largest digital publisher in SA. Then there are the niche broadcast media assets in SA, as well as promising radio and television platforms in Kenya, Nigeria and Ghana. TBG is also the owner of a sprawling music (Gallo) and independent film catalogue, and a serious player in the retail solutions market through Hirt & Carter. There are several factors that make TBG worth mulling as an investment at this juncture, besides the underlying operating assets appearing woefully undervalued.
